An early peak characterized by foundational issues in new models, particularly with transmissions and early electronics. Models like the first-generation XC90 and S80 experienced significant power train problems and early electrical system integration challenges as Volvo transitioned to more complex electronic architectures.
The highest peak in complaint volume, coinciding with the introduction of the SPA platform (new XC90, S90/V90, XC60). This era is dominated by electrical and equipment issues, especially related to the new Sensus infotainment system, alongside significant engine complaints concerning oil consumption. The 2016 peak represents Volvo's most challenging reliability period.
Volvo's most complained-about model with 5,214 complaints. The first generation (2003-2006) was plagued by automatic transmission failures. The second generation, launched in 2016, triggered the manufacturer's highest-ever peak in complaints, primarily centered on ELECTRICAL SYSTEM and EQUIPMENT issues, including the Sensus infotainment screen freezing, rebooting, and losing functionality. Engine oil consumption was also prevalent.
With 4,016 complaints, the S60 peaked around 2012-2016 model years. The most dominant issue is excessive oil consumption, categorized under ENGINE complaints. Other major issues include ELECTRICAL SYSTEM and general EQUIPMENT failures. There's a noticeable gap between the high volume of specific oil consumption complaints and targeted, effective TSBs addressing the root cause for all affected owners.
The XC60's 3,939 complaints spiked with the redesigned 2018 model year. Primary complaints revolve around EQUIPMENT and ELECTRICAL SYSTEM, mirroring XC90 problems. Owners frequently report infotainment system issues, phantom braking from collision avoidance systems, and various electronic glitches. SERVICE BRAKES complaints are also more prominent for the XC60 compared to other top models.
